Chemical composition of ginger

As a part of ginger, a lot of nutrients have been found, therefore using it even small amounts, you will get a great benefit, especially since in the marinated form it retains almost all its properties.

  1. Ginger is a source of vitamins B1, B2, C and A, so it is useful for vessels, eyes, skin and nervous system.
  2. Mineral substances are present in the rhizome of this plant: calcium, potassium, iron, phosphorus, zinc. They are necessary for the construction of bone tissue, maintaining the normal functioning of the heart and circulatory system, to create their own proteins.
  3. Useful properties of pink pickled ginger due to a rich amino acid composition. Including it also contains the essential amino acids methionine, lysine, threonine and valine, the lack of which is observed most often.
  4. His spicy taste of ginger is obliged gingerolu. This substance has a warming effect, so drinks with ginger are good for the prevention and treatment of colds, and even gingerol speeds up metabolism, works as a mild laxative, which is why ginger is so popular with losing weight.
  5. What is useful is pickled ginger yet, so it's the ability to thin the blood, normalize cholesterol and blood glucose levels, preventing the formation of thrombi and atherosclerotic plaques.
  6. Due to the presence of essential oils, ginger stimulates the production of digestive enzymes and thus improves digestion.
  7. It is believed that the beneficial properties of pickled ginger extend to the reproductive system. In men, it increases potency and helps prevent the development of prostatitis, and in women leads the uterus in tone.

And these properties of pickled ginger are not limited. For example, it helps fight headaches, effectively removes odor from the mouth and works as a bactericide.

Contraindications for use

It is not recommended to eat ginger for pregnant and lactating women. Also, people with liver diseases should be discarded. Ginger can be harmful in cholelithiasis, as it produces a choleretic effect. People who have gastritis, peptic ulcer and colitis in an acute stage will have to abstain from it. Hypertonics need to include ginger in the diet with great caution, since it raises blood pressure. Finally, do not forget about individual intolerance and allergic reactions if you try marinated ginger for the first time.
